Ingredients:

  • 12 oz sem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 1 tbsp coconut oil
  • 6 oz white chocolate chips
  • 3 drops oil-based food coloring
  • 1 tbsp edible silver stars
  • 1 pinch flaky sea salt

Instructions:

  1.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per, ensuring the edges overlap the sides of the pan.
  2. Place semi-sweet chocolate and oil in a microwave-safe bowl. Heat in 30-second bursts, stirring between intervals, until smooth. Pour onto the center of the pan and spread into a thin rectangle.
  3. Melt white chocolate using the microwave burst method. Divide the melted white chocolate into three small bowls and stir in oil-based colors.
  4. Drop small dollops of colored white chocolate randomly across the semi-sweet base. Use a toothpick to gently swirl the colors in circular motions.
  5. Sprinkle edible stars and sea salt over the wet chocolate.
  6.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es until the surface is firm to the touch.
